微机原理与接口技术复习重点:CPU结构与存储器扩展

需积分: 3 2 下载量 77 浏览量 更新于2024-07-25 收藏 251KB DOC 举报
"微机原理与接口技术的学习资料,涵盖了8086/8088、80486、Pentium系列CPU的基本结构、工作原理、虚拟存储技术、汇编语言程序设计以及存储器扩展设计等多个知识点,旨在帮助考生掌握微机系统的核心概念和技术。" 本文将详细讲解微机原理与接口技术的相关知识点,这些知识对于理解和使用微处理器至关重要。 首先,8086/8088 CPU是早期的微处理器,它们分别有16个数据管脚和20个地址管脚。80486 CPU采用了多级流水线结构,提高执行指令的速度,而Pentium系列则进一步优化,采用两条并行指令流水线,以提升处理效率。在80386之后的系统中,高速缓存(Cache)被引入,作为CPU与主存之间的缓冲,以减少访问主存的延迟。 虚拟存储技术是现代计算机系统中内存管理的关键,它通过硬件和软件的结合,使得内存和外存(如硬盘)形成一个连续的逻辑空间。这种技术使得程序可以使用比实际物理内存更大的地址空间,提高了系统对大内存需求的处理能力。 8086/8088 CPU的内部结构包括执行单元(EU)和总线接口单元(BIU),其中BIU包含指令队列,用于暂存待执行的指令。微机系统的存储器管理采用分段和分页机制,将内存划分为代码段、数据段、堆栈段等。汇编语言是与机器语言紧密相关的编程语言,包括指令性语句(产生机器码)和指示性语句(提供汇编信息)。 汇编语言程序设计通常涉及顺序程序、分支程序、循环程序和子程序这四种基本结构。存储器扩展设计有位扩展、字扩展和字位扩展等方式,以适应不同容量的需求。片选信号的产生方法有线选法、部分译码法和全译码法,用于选择和激活特定的存储器芯片。 此外,半导体存储器分为随机访问存储器(RAM)和只读存储器(ROM)。RAM又包括静态RAM(SRAM)和动态RAM(DRAM),而ROM则有掩模ROM、EPROM和EEPROM等类型。存储器扩展设计中的位扩展用于增加数据宽度,字扩展则增加存储容量,字位扩展则是两者的结合。 80486 CPU内部包含高速缓存,例如,Pentium芯片中的Cache分为数据Cache和指令Cache,分别用于存放执行指令和数据,以提高数据处理速度。这些知识点构成了微机原理与接口技术的基础,对理解微处理器的工作原理和系统设计至关重要。